Important Topics
Prioritize these topics for maximum marks.
Linear Equations in One Variable
Solving equations with one variable, including word problems. Essential for building algebraic foundations.
Algebraic Expressions and Identities
Operations on algebraic expressions, factorization, and application of standard identities (e.g., (a+b)^2).
Mensuration
Area of 2D shapes (trapezium, rhombus) and surface area/volume of 3D shapes (cube, cuboid, cylinder). Formula application is key.
Comparing Quantities
Ratios, percentages, profit & loss, simple & compound interest. Application-based problems are common.
Understanding Quadrilaterals
Properties of different types of quadrilaterals (parallelogram, rhombus, rectangle, square, kite, trapezium).
Squares and Square Roots, Cubes and Cube Roots
Finding square roots and cube roots by prime factorization and division methods. Properties of square and cube numbers.
Data Handling
Organizing data, bar graphs, pie charts, histograms, probability basics.
Exponents and Powers
Laws of exponents with integer and rational powers. Standard form of numbers.

Chapter-Wise Preparation Strategy for CBSE Class 8 Mathematics
A well-defined chapter-wise preparation strategy is fundamental to excelling in CBSE Class 8 Mathematics. Tutors should guide students through a systematic approach, ensuring thorough understanding and practice for each unit. Start with Rational Numbers and Linear Equations in One Variable, as these form the bedrock for algebra. Emphasize conceptual clarity, properties, and various methods of solving equations. For Understanding Quadrilaterals and Practical Geometry, focus on definitions, properties of different quadrilaterals, and accurate construction techniques. Regular practice of drawing figures is crucial here.
Data Handling requires students to understand different types of graphs (bar graphs, pie charts, histograms) and methods of organizing and interpreting data. Squares and Square Roots, Cubes and Cube Roots involve understanding the concepts and memorizing perfect squares/cubes up to a certain extent, along with methods for finding roots. Comparing Quantities is an important chapter that integrates ratios, percentages, profit/loss, and simple/compound interest – a chapter that often requires extensive problem-solving practice.
Algebraic Expressions and Identities and Factorisation are core to future mathematical studies; students must master expansion, factorization, and application of identities. Mensuration demands memorization of formulas for areas and volumes of 2D and 3D shapes, coupled with application-based problems. Finally, Exponents and Powers and Direct and Inverse Proportions require understanding the rules and applying them correctly in various contexts. For each chapter, the strategy should involve: understanding concepts, solving textbook examples, practicing a variety of problems from sample papers, and regular revision to ensure retention and mastery.
Common Mistakes in CBSE Class 8 Mathematics and How to Avoid Them
Students often make recurring errors in CBSE Class 8 Mathematics, which can significantly impact their scores. Tutors play a crucial role in highlighting these pitfalls and guiding students to avoid them. One of the most common mistakes is calculation errors, particularly with negative numbers, fractions, and decimals. To combat this, encourage students to double-check their arithmetic and to practice mental math regularly. Another frequent error lies in misinterpreting word problems. Students often struggle to translate the given information into a correct mathematical equation. Tutors should train students to read questions carefully, identify keywords, and break down complex problems into smaller, manageable steps, perhaps even drawing diagrams to visualize the scenario.
Conceptual misunderstandings are also prevalent, especially in topics like algebraic identities or properties of quadrilaterals. For example, confusing a rhombus with a square, or incorrectly applying exponent rules. The remedy here is to ensure strong foundational understanding through clear explanations, examples, and asking probing questions to check comprehension. Students also tend to skip steps in solutions, especially for longer answer questions, leading to loss of partial marks. Emphasize the importance of showing all working, even for seemingly obvious steps, as it demonstrates their thought process and helps in identifying where an error might have occurred.
Finally, poor time management during exams can lead to incomplete papers. Regular practice with timed sample papers helps students develop a sense of pacing. Tutors should teach them to allocate time per question based on its mark weightage and to move on if they get stuck on a particular problem, returning to it later if time permits. By proactively addressing these common mistakes, tutors can significantly enhance student performance and confidence.
